Nowell will start for Chiefs against London Irish

$
0
0
TEENAGER Jack Nowell will make his Exeter Chiefs league debut on Sunday after being named in the team to face London Irish.
The 19-year-old has been picked on the right wing for Sunday's match at the Madejski Stadium (3pm).
Nowell, who normally plays at full-back, was an unused replacement in Exeter's 25-24 defeat against London Welsh in the Premiership in September but will now make his first appearance in the top flight.
He started both of the club's LV= Cup matches and scored a brace of tries in the 42-15 against London Welsh two weeks ago.
Nowell, who has been playing on a dual contract with the Cornish Pirates this season, is one of three changes from the side that beat Worcester 33-9 in the last league outing.
He replaces Gonzalo Camacho, who is away with Argentina, while James Hanks replaces Aly Muldowney in the second row and a fit-again Jason Shoemark returns in the centre in place of Sireli Naqelevuki.
Muldowney and Naqeleuki are named on the bench, which sees Hoani Tui selected after proving his fitness in the two LV= Cup matches. Tom Johnson, having been dropped by England, is also a replacement for the Chiefs this weekend, with Dean Mumm continuing at blindside.
Exeter Chiefs: Arscott; Nowell, Dollman, Shoemark, Jess; Steenson, Thomas; Sturgess, Whitehead, Rimmer, Hayes, Hanks, Mumm, Scaysbrook, Baxter. Reps: Alcott, Moon, Tui, Muldowney, Johnson, Barrett, Mieres, Naqelevuki
